hankie Everything User ID: 69995420 United States 08/24/2015 09:40 AM Report Abusive Post Report Copyright Violation | Beans is protein so a must, find some spices or bacon bits to put back seasoning make them taste better, shorten and bacon bit or only the flavored ones. Rice it had nutrition in it, can be use with pinto beans my favorite, taste better the second day. Tomatoes, potato flake, flour, powder milk, canned meat if you can find it, chicken is good, beef, tuna, etc. Common sense buying, do not buy unless you will eat it and it need to be able to have shelf life. You need soap and other personal items, medical supplies for fever, headache, cuts and thing like this. Toilet paper. Garbage bags, normal things plus containers for water. If you look, just use your brain, you can do it, just know you are putting away thing you will eat, not what you will not eat just more of it. Just make sure you keep the food so it stays well and the bean if you get them put in a sack and in the freezer they keep longer or the refrigerator. All thing like thing to drink, things to and spice to food to give favor like salt, pepper and different spices. Just make sure you get soup making because it goes farther. If you can store cracker buy them of not, learn to make fried bread, just shortening flour and some water if nothing else, you and some shortening to the flour mix, make it not like pancake but not to thick drop some in hot to medium hot oil or shortening and let it cook like pancakes bubbles on the sides and flip works great, taste good too. Self rising flour or make the flour with baking powder soda and salt it is on the package. Or get a cook book with a from scratch biscuit. then again there is ready made biscuit mix you can buy extra.
